Forecast: Maize Demand in Ghana

The demand for maize in Ghana has shown an overall growth trend from 1.75 million metric tons in 2014 to 2.35 million metric tons in 2023. The year-on-year variations indicate fluctuations, such as a significant increase of 14.55% in 2018 and slight decreases of 2.39% and 3.32% in 2019 and 2020, respectively. The average compound annual growth rate (CAGR) over the past five years stands at 0.83%. Forecasted data suggests a steady growth with an anticipated increase to 2.54 million metric tons by 2028, reflecting a forecasted 5-year CAGR of 1.22%.

Future trends to watch for include potential impacts of climatic changes on maize yield, policy changes related to agricultural practices, and technological advancements in farming. Any shift in these factors could significantly alter the demand and supply dynamics for maize in Ghana.
